High School Name: Central (BR) High School

Head Coach: Sham Gabehart

Classification: Class 5A (Non-Select D-I)

District: 4-5A

2025 Record: 23-13

2025 Playoff Finish: Regional Finalist

No. of Returning Positional Starters: 4

No. of Returning Pitchers: 0

Team Strengths: Power & Defense

Top Upperclassmen (2026 & 2027 Class): 2026 RHP/INF Cole Guidroz (LSU-Eunice), 2026 OF/RHP Brayson Hartzog (Coastal Alabama North CC), 2026 1B Brady Wiles (Millsaps), 2027 C Cooper Austin, 2027 OF Reece Tillman, 2026 RHP Darian Diaz, 2026 RHP Evan Dauzat, 2027 1B/C Lane Billings

Top Underclassmen (2028 & 2029 Class): 2028 UTL Parker Simcoe, 2028 INF Aaron Keller, 2028 INF Chase Chandler, 2028 RHP Brodee Smith

 


Team Preview

The Central Wildcats enter 2026 with as much optimism as any program in the Baton Rouge area. After a 23-win campaign a year ago, Head Coach Sham Gabehart’s club believes it has the ingredients to take a significant step forward this spring. With more physicality throughout the lineup, improved team defense, and a deeper stable of arms, Central expects to be firmly in the state-title conversation.

The Wildcats should feature noticeably more thump in the lineup this season, with legitimate power threats scattered throughout the order. Defensively, they’ve made strides across the diamond, and while untested on the varsity stage, the pitching staff runs deeper than in years past, providing multiple options for innings.

The biggest question for Central is how quickly its arms — talented but largely unproven — can adjust to varsity speed. With no returning starters on the mound, early-season growth and development will be critical.

Top Returning Players

Senior INF/RHP Cole Guidroz

A tough, competitive senior who will anchor the infield and provide a veteran presence in the middle of the order. Guidroz will also be counted on for important innings as one of the few upperclassmen with experience on the mound.

Junior C Cooper Austin

A key piece behind the plate, Austin handles the staff well and brings leadership to a young group of arms. He should take another step forward offensively this spring.

Junior OF Reece Tillman

An athletic outfielder who covers ground and brings energy to the top of the lineup. Tillman’s ability to get on base and cause havoc will be important to Central’s offensive identity.

Senior OF/RHP Brayson Hartzog

One of the most athletic players on the roster, Hartzog will impact the Wildcats in multiple ways. He provides a power-speed blend in the outfield and will be a meaningful contributor on the mound as well.

Senior 1B Brady Wiles

A physical corner infielder who brings middle-of-the-order impact. Wiles adds to the team’s renewed power profile and will be counted on to drive in runs consistently.

 

Sophomore UTL Parker Simcoe

A versatile young talent who can plug into multiple spots defensively. Simcoe’s athleticism and baseball IQ make him an important piece of the Wildcats’ lineup construction.

Sophomore INF Aaron Keller

Another sophomore expected to take on a significant role. Keller has advanced actions on the dirt and should continue to grow into his offensive game.

 

Upperclassmen Ready to Make an Impact

Senior RHP Darian Diaz

A late-blooming arm with a fastball up to 88 mph. Diaz may emerge as one of the key rotation pieces as the Wildcats establish new leaders on the mound.

Senior RHP Evan Dauzat

A change-of-pace look who can generate weak contact and attack lineups differently. Dauzat will be valuable in matchup situations and leverage innings.

Junior C/1B Lane Billings

A strong addition to the roster, Billings brings depth at catcher and first base, along with an experienced bat that should help lengthen the lineup.

Underclassmen to Watch

Sophomore RHP Brodee Smith

A young arm with upside who will compete for innings right away. Smith’s development will be a key storyline early in the season.

 

Sophomore RHP/INF Chase Chandler

A dual-role athlete who brings versatility and a mature approach for his age. Chandler should see time both on the dirt and on the mound as he continues to progress.

 
Outlook

Central expects to be a legitimate state contender in 2026. The lineup has the potential to produce runs in bunches, with power threats scattered throughout the order, while the defense looks more polished than last year. The biggest variable remains the pitching staff — talented, deep, and competitive, but light on varsity experience. If the young arms settle in quickly, the Wildcats have the roster makeup to be one of the top programs in Class 5A this spring.
